  • Abstract
    Two polymeric ferro-complexes were first synthesized from FeSO4·7H2O and poly(Schiff base)s. The poly(Schiff base)s were prepared by polycondensation of 5,5′-dimethyl-2,2′-diamino-4,4′-bithiazole (MDABT) with oxalic aldehyde and isophthalaldehyde, respectively. The structures of polymers and complexes were characterized by IR and 1H NMR spectra. The Fe contents of complexes were measured by X-ray spectrometer. The magnetic behavior of the complexes was examined as a function of magnetic field strength at 4 K and as a function of temperature (4–300 K). The results show that PMTOA-Fe2+ is a soft ferromagnet while PMTIA-Fe2+ exhibits features of an antiferromagnet.
